Manchester City midfielder Yaya Toure could join sister club New York City FC at the end of the season.

That is according to the Daily Star, who say the Ivorian is seen as a potential successor to Andrea Pirlo who will retire at the end of the current MLS campaign.

Toure was given a new one-year deal at City but has played just twice this term amid a clutch of competition in a midfield packed with talent.

Former Arsenal and Man City midfielder Patrick Vieira is in charge in the Big Apple.
